OVERVIEW:

Join the Strategic Transport Analysis Team (STAT) and be at the forefront of groundbreaking energy technology research. STAT is a dynamic and forward-thinking organization committed to shaping the future of energy through innovative research and cutting-edge technologies. We invite you to be a key contributor to our team and play a pivotal role in advancing the energy industry.

As a research scientist in technology innovations and data science, you will lead in-depth research, providing insights into the dynamic landscape of energy technologies. Your expertise will be crucial in adapting to the evolving dynamics of the energy sector.

PRINCIPAL DUTIES:

· Conduct research on supply chain and applications of carbon-based materials, battery critical materials, batteries, and H2:

· Utilize data analysis to understand the supply and demand of key materials and energy carriers.

· Design and create compelling visualizations to effectively communicate trends in material supply chain and technologies.

· Conduct research on energy technology outlook:

· Conduct insightful research to provide long-term perspectives on energy technologies through life-cycle, techno-economic, and supply chain analysis.

· Conduct thorough data analysis to identify and evaluate trends in energy technologies, focusing on advancements in sustainable solutions.

· Develop and implement statistical models and machine learning algorithms to forecast future trends and support strategic decision.

· Author high-quality research papers, technical reports, and proposals:

· Employ data visualization and statistical analysis to communicate research findings effectively.

· Manage and monitor the progress of multiple projects:

· Apply project management skills to oversee data-driven projects in response to changing demands in the energy and transportation sectors.

· Stay informed about scientific and technical developments:

· Actively participate in professional societies and technical committees, leveraging data science to stay at the forefront of industry developments.

· Provide consultations to senior management on research strategies and plans:

· Offer data-driven insights to guide strategic decision-making in research initiatives.

M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S:

· B.S. Degree in Science/Engineering/Physics/Mathematics Discipline as appropriate for the area of expertise for the assigned jobs. M.S./Ph.D. Degree highly desired.

· Seven years (7) experience in a substantive industrial, technological or laboratory area relevant to the jobs assignment.

· Proficiency in Python and SQL, with data science applications. Strong understanding of natural language processing (NLP) and text mining/information retrieval. Experience with large language models (LLMs), such as autonomous agents and retrieval-augmented generation (RAG), is preferred.

· Must be able to communicate and comprehend accurately, clearly and concisely in English at a level required to perform the job as outlined.

· Candidate should be comfortable in working independently or part of a project team, frequent project presentation and travel to meetings at conferences and universities.
